Clonorchiasis is caused by a chronic infestation of liver flukes, Clonorchis sinensis, and these reside mainly in the medium- and small-sized intrahepatic bile ducts. Therefore, diffuse, uniform, minimal or mild dilatation of these bile ducts, particularly in the periphery, without dilatation of the extrahepatic bile duct is the typical finding on several imaging modalities. Primary biliary cirrhosis (PBC) is characterized by antimitochondrial autoantibodies (AMAs) in patients' sera and histologically by chronic nonsuppurative destructive cholangitis in small bile ducts, eventually followed by extensive bile duct loss and biliary cirrhosis. The major duodenal papilla (papilla of Vater) is the point where the dilated junction of the bile and pancreatic ducts (ampulla of Vater) enter the duodenum. Bile is a liver-harvested liquid compound that plays role in digestion. It travels through system of branching bile ducts known as the biliary tree. The hepatocytes generate at cellular level, and canaliculi, which are thin tubular channels, collect it [1,2].

The biliary trees descend from the canaliculi at the hepatocytes in the liver. Bile drains from this level into intrahepatic ducts, smaller ducts combine to form the segmental bile ducts which within the liver gradually enlarge and merge to the right and left hepatic ducts.
